City Manager Pat Ford Lauds Bridgeport's Parks and Recreation Staff for Ongoing Snow Removal Work

By Connect-Bridgeport Staff on January 09, 2025

As the winter weather refuses to let up, Bridgeport City Manager Patrick Ford insists that staff responsible for keeping roads and sidewalks clear have not let up as well.
 
Recently, Ford piled praise on members on the Bridgeport Public Works Department for hours of work and extra shifts earlier this week to keep the city's roadways in good condition despite the onslaught of preciptiation and unrelenting cold weathers continually below freezing. He also was on hand as praised was handed out to the staff of The Bridge for getting their facility's massive parking lots cleared to allow for a Tuesday opening.
 
While continuing to thank those workers, he also added the Bridgeport Parks and Recreation Departmentto the list. In a recent social media post from the city sharing Ford's thoughts, he praised them for being out all day and continuing to work until snow is removed from sidewalks throughout the city.
 
"The snow is heavy and deep... so this has not been an easy task," the post said.
 
Ford asked that motorists and others passing by to be mindful of their presence as they contineu to work to keep the roadways and sidewalks clears as more snow came down yesterday and even more snow is anticipated this weekend.
